DSWD to start special validation of Senior Citizens

MALATE, MANILA–Targeting 5,652 senior citizens across five island provinces in MiMaRoPa, the Department of Social Welfare and Development (DSWD) Field Office IV-MiMaRoPa thru the Listahanan will be deploying field staff on April 2014 to conduct house-to-house interviews to determine the poverty status of Social Pension Program recipients. IP households need interventions

The Listahanan or National Household Targeting System for Poverty Reduction (NHTSPR) of the Department of Social Welfare and Development (DSWD)  Field Office IV-MiMaRoPa has assessed 80 Indigenous People (IP) tribes that constitutes to 74, 323  poor IP households (HH) equivalent to 339, 301 poor individuals across the five provinces in MiMaRoPa region. DSWD MiMaRoPa continues aid packs distribution to Yolanda victims

Malate, Manila– The Department of Social Welfare and Development (DSWD) Field Office IV- MiMaRoPa will distribute an additional 4,000 relief packs to families affected by the Super Typhoon Yolanda in the Northern part of Palawan province. DSWD launches new Listahanan

Calapan City- The Department of Social Welfare and Development (DSWD) Field Office IV-MiMaRoPa has launched the new brand name of the National Household Targeting System for Poverty Reduction called ‘Listahanan’ last October 30, 2013.
